An Interview with Chris Holden

Chris Holden, President of Heraeus Kulzer North America, says the changing economic environment will continue to drive the adoption of digitization in dental laboratories.

Inside Dental Technology: What factors impacting dentistry are pushing the envelope on adoption of technology in the dental office and laboratory?

Chris Holden: So-called corporate dentistry is forcing cost reduction. As a result, manufacturers of hardware, software, and chemistry products are facing market forces that compel technological advancement. In addition to ‘corporate’ ownership, we see labor shortages in laboratories that continue to drive automation needs. The convergence of these two factors coupled with the megatrends of rising student debt, demographic changes, and the expansion of commerce via the Internet really alter the landscape as we know it today and ought to accelerate the advancement and adoption rate of technology for both the dental office and the laboratory.

 

IDT: What indicators are impacting the need for digitizing the removable segment of dentistry, and why is digitization important for the future of the industry?

CH: Simply stated, economics are impacting the need to digitize the removable segment. As mentioned before, automation through digitization provides scalability to every laboratory while providing a way to deliver high-quality dentures in a shorter period. As for the dentists, Pala Digital Dentures will provide them a cost-effective denture solution by eliminating wasteful, unnecessary appointments, thereby shortening treatment and chair time, and by utilizing “digital dentures” to expand billing revenue in two ways: 1) attracting new patients with a novel and advanced treatment method; and 2) creating a stronger value proposition for patients, enabling the practice to increase its patient acceptance rate.

 

IDT: What are the specific benefits of digital dentures for the patient, clinician, and laboratory?

CH: For dentists and patients, the benefits are greater accuracy, better fit, and fewer appointments. Chair-time savings are a huge motivator for the laboratory’s clients.

For laboratories, the benefits include greater gross margins and scalability without fixed overhead growth. Capital can be expensive and, at times, difficult to acquire. When laboratories do not have access to expensive equipment, they need to be able to turn to someone who has invested in the most advanced technology. Laboratories can leverage that infrastructure without having to bear the capital cost alone. Outsourced automation through digitization has proven to be an effective method for laboratories to compete with offshore business as well as to lower their fixed overheads, translating into greater profitability. Laboratories can scale their business needs without having the burden of legacy costs.

IDT: What future trends do you see?

CH: Relating to digital dentures, we see a number of advancements. We will see a number of competitors attempt to offer digital dentures. The most important advancement will be cutting out time while improving the delivered appliance with respect to fit, form, and function. Driving costs out of this process will continue to be our focus. We see a number of changes happening with materials science that will allow for faster production methods harmonizing with cost reduction. And finally, we see a combination of both centralized and decentralized production servicing denture case needs; both of these models will support the disparate business models we see in the market.
